WebOct 29, 2001 · Plants can be damaged by infectious microbes such as fungi, bacteria, viruses, and nematodes. They can also be damaged by noninfectious factors, causing problems that can colle ctively be termed "abiotic diseases" or "abiotic disorders". WebBiotic diseases can spread throughout one plant and also may spread to neighboring plants of the same species. Wind-blown rain is a common way for disease agents to spread from plant to plant. Biotic diseases sometimes show physical evidence ( signs ) of the pathogen, such as fungal growth, bacterial ooze, or nematode cysts, or the presence of ...
